Johnny Manziel accused of striking ex-girlfriend, according to police

HOUSTON – Johnny Manziel is in hot water yet again.

A Jan. 30 Fort Worth police report has surfaced cataloging a night filled with violence and threats.

According to police, Manziel and his ex-girlfriend Colleen Crowley went out for a night of bar hopping around the Dallas area. After their group of friends disbursed, Manziel and Crowley were left alone at Zaza Hotel in Dallas. 

In the report, Crowley says Manziel seemed like he was on some sort of drugs, but insisted that he was not intoxicated. The report states Manziel struck Crowley several times in the hotel before he said he would drive her home because she was intoxicated.

Police said Manziel and Crowley got into his car and started driving towards her apartment in Fort Worth, where Crowley resides. During the drive home, the report says Manziel's erratic behavior continued, including more violence and shouting directed towards Crowley.

Once they returned to Crowley's apartment, according to reports, Crowley said she was running in and out of her apartment in an attempt to get away from Manziel. According to reports, this is when Manziel fled on foot in an unknown direction.

Police were unable to locate Manziel after an exhaustive search by helicopters and ground patrol, according to police.

Crowley became very uncooperative when officers attempted to get a statement from her. She also refused to let officers photograph her or any of her injuries, according to reports.

Due to the uncooperative nature of Crowley, an information-only report was completed.
